Rain Gutter Clearing in Bergen County, NJ

Rain gutter clearing services involve the removal of leaves, debris, and obstructions from the gutters and downspouts of residential properties. This maintenance helps ensure proper water flow away from the foundation, preventing potential water damage, basement flooding, and landscape erosion. Projects typically cover both routine cleanings and emergency cleanouts, especially after storms or seasonal changes when gutters are more likely to become clogged. Homeowners often seek this service to maintain the integrity of their roofing system, avoid pest infestations, and protect the overall condition of their property.

Before requesting gutter clearing, property owners usually want to understand the scope of the work involved, including whether the service includes inspection for potential damage or leaks. It’s also helpful to know if the service covers different types of gutter systems, such as seamless or sectional gutters, and if any additional repairs or maintenance are recommended following the cleaning. Clarifying these details can help ensure the project meets the specific needs of the property and prevents future issues related to improper drainage.

Common Rain Gutter Clearing Jobs

Rain Gutter Clearing - Removal of leaves, twigs, and debris to prevent clogs.

Gutter Inspection - Checking for damage or leaks that could cause water issues.

Downspout Cleaning - Clearing blockages to ensure proper water flow away from the foundation.

Gutter Flushing - Rinsing out gutters to remove dirt and buildup for optimal performance.

Gutter Maintenance - Addressing minor repairs and securing loose brackets or fasteners.

Seasonal Gutter Services - Preparing gutters for heavy rain or snow to avoid overflow or damage.

Rain Gutter Clearing Questions

What is gutter clearing? Gutter clearing involves removing leaves, debris, and obstructions from roof gutters to ensure proper water flow and prevent damage.

How often should gutters be cleaned? Gutters should typically be cleaned at least twice a year, especially during fall and spring, or more frequently if there are many trees nearby.

Why is gutter cleaning important? Regular cleaning helps prevent water overflow, foundation issues, roof damage, and pest infestations caused by clogged gutters.

What types of debris are commonly removed? Common debris includes leaves, twigs, dirt, nests, and other materials that can block water flow in gutters.
